SUMMARY

When I want to connect to an existing VPN, I click the applet icon and then click the VPN connection I want (often the first one under "Available connections"). However, due to wifi scanning, a wifi connection suddenly appears in its place and I click on that instead which is almost as infuriating as when I accidentally click an ad because my browser re-arranged a page while loading.

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Have a wifi connection available (but not currently connected. This often happens if you have a 2.4/5g router).
2. Click applet with the intent to connect to a VPN
2. Click on the VPN to initiate the connection
3. Realise wifi scanning changed the order and you have accidentally clicked on the wrong item
4. Be frustrated enough to file a bug report

OBSERVED RESULT

Clicked on the wrong network connection

EXPECTED RESULT

Items do not suddenly change so that the user can click on the wrong item. I wont pretend to be a UI expert and come up with an alternative for the UI, but re-arranging items after presenting them to the user is a good way for them to click on the wrong one.
